WebQ-8: May a taxpayer include labor costs when calculating the credits? A-8: When calculating the § 25C credit, a taxpayer may include the labor costs for the onsite preparation, assembly, or original installation of residential energy property such as qualifying electric heat pumps, qualifying air conditioners, and qualifying biomass stoves.
